Prokofiev - Tales of an Old Grandmother, Op. 31 for Euphonium and Piano Borodin The poem was inspired byAlso known as Four Grandmother Songs and Old Granny Tales, this work was composed in New York in 1918 at the beginning of the composers self imposed exile from Russia after its Revolution. These short pieces were immediately successful and were performed worldwide.
